【问题标题】:how to solve time-out HYT00 teraData如何解决超时 HYT00 teraData
【发布时间】:2013-07-11 06:41:56
【问题描述】:

我一直在研究 asp.net 和图表,我想运行一个可以在图表中显示数据的查询。

但是,查询会花费大量时间,并且每次出现错误时都会超时。

查询是:

select    Colum, 

SUM(CASE WHEN column1 = 1 THEN column2 END)mins, 
 SUM(column3)AS rev, 
SUM(column4)AS qty

from table1 
where column5  between Date-10 and Date 
group by 1 
order by column5;

如何增加超时值?请帮忙!

【问题讨论】:

    标签: sql timeout teradata query-timeout


    【解决方案1】:

    当您使用 ODBC 数据源管理器时,Teradata 的 ODBC 驱动程序中没有查询超时设置(只有登录超时),它必须由应用程序使用带有 SQLSetStmtAttr() 的 SQL_ATTR_QUERY_TIMEOUT 属性进行设置。

    并且默认为零,这意味着没有超时,所以这必须由 Visual Studio 应用(全局默认自动应用于所有连接?)或您的程序。

    【讨论】:

      猜你喜欢
      • 2016-10-31
      • 2021-03-23
      • 1970-01-01
      • 2018-06-09
      • 2019-04-01
      • 2023-03-10
      • 2021-08-07
      • 2019-08-10
      • 2019-07-18
      相关资源
      最近更新 更多